Northville Township Millage Renewal on the August 4 Ballot
The current Northville Township millage is set to expire at the end of this year. Residents will be asked to consider a millage renewal on the August 4 ballot.
This proposal represents a renewal of an existing millage, not a new or additional tax.
What does the millage fund?
If approved, the millage would continue funding operations for existing Township services, including:
- Police
- Fire
- Emergency Medical Services (EMS)
- Parks & Recreation
- Senior Services
- Youth Network
Public safety services—Police, Fire and EMS—represent the largest portion of the proposed funding.
Proposed Millage Details
- Term: 8 years
- Rate: 7.2054 mills (2025 rollback rate)
- Estimated Cost: Approximately $7.21 per $1,000 of taxable value
How Funds Would Be Allocated
- Public Safety: 6.3447 mills
- Parks, Senior & Youth Services: 0.7452 mills
- General Operating: 0.1155 mills
Understanding Millages
A mill represents $1 of tax for every $1,000 of a property’s taxable value.
